Espresso Martini Recipe – The Perfect Coffee Cocktail with Vodka
The Espresso Martini is a rich and sophisticated coffee cocktail that perfectly balances bold espresso, smooth vodka, and the sweet coffee liqueur Kahlua. Created in the 1980s by bartender Dick Bradsell, the Espresso Martini has gained global popularity as a luxurious after-dinner drink and a favorite among coffee lovers. Its velvety texture, enticing aroma, and signature creamy foam top make it an elegant choice for any occasion. Equipment Needed
- Cocktail shaker
- Fine mesh strainer
- Jigger (for measuring ingredients)
- Espresso machine or coffee maker
- Martini glass
Ingredients
- 1 ½ ounces (45ml) vodka
- 1 ounce (30ml) coffee liqueur (Kahlua)
- 1 ounce (30ml) freshly brewed espresso (cooled)
- ½ ounce (15ml) simple syrup (optional, for sweetness)
- Ice cubes
- 3 coffee beans (for garnish)
Instructions
Step 1: Brew the Espresso
Brew a fresh shot of espresso and allow it to cool slightly. Using high-quality espresso enhances the depth and richness of the drink.
Step 2: Prepare the Shaker
Fill a cocktail shaker with ice cubes to chill the ingredients properly and create a frothy texture.
Step 3: Add Ingredients
Pour the vodka, coffee liqueur, freshly brewed espresso, and simple syrup (if using) into the shaker.
Step 4: Shake Vigorously
Secure the lid on the shaker and shake vigorously for about 15-20 seconds. This helps to aerate the drink and create a signature frothy top.
Step 5: Strain and Serve
Strain the mixture through a fine mesh strainer into a chilled martini glass. The strainer helps achieve a smooth texture while preserving the delicate foam.
Step 6: Garnish and Enjoy
Float three coffee beans on top of the foam as a classic garnish, symbolizing health, wealth, and happiness. Serve immediately.

Tips for the Perfect Espresso Martini
- Use Fresh Espresso: Freshly brewed espresso enhances the bold coffee flavor and provides the signature foam.
- Shake Well: The harder you shake, the better the frothy top will be.
- Chill Your Glass: A cold martini glass keeps the drink crisp and refreshing.
- Experiment with Flavors: Try adding a dash of vanilla extract or a hint of chocolate liqueur for a unique twist.
